Kafka是一个高度可扩展的消息系统,它在LinkedIn的中央数据库管理中扮演着十分重要的角色,因其可水平扩展和高吞吐率而被广泛使用,现在已经被多家不同类型的公司作为多种类型的数据管道和消息系统。
那么,如何学习Kafka源码??
我觉得最高效的方式就是去读最核心的源码,先看一张 Kafka结构图 以及 Kafka 源码全景图
Spirng IOC
1.Spring框架
2.Spring IOC 容器 Bean 对象实例化模拟
3.Spring IOC 配置文件加载
4.Spring IOC 容器 Bean 对象实例化
5.Spring IOC 注入
6.Spring IOC 扫描器
7.Bean的作用域与生命周期
Spirng AOP核心组件分析
Spring IOC+AOP源码笔记
1.Spring入门和IOC介绍
2.对象依赖
3.AOP入门
4.JDBCTemplate和Spring事务
5.Spring事务原理
6.Spring事务的一个线程安全问题
7.IOC再回顾以及我常问的面试题
8.AOP再回顾
Spring源码学习总结(篇幅有限)
Spring MVC
Spring Boot
Spring Cloud Alibaba
Spring Cloud(篇幅有限)
各类脑图
1.Spring
2.Spring Cloud
3.Spring Boot
最后
光给面试题不给答案不是我的风格。这里面的面试题也只是凤毛麟角,还有答案的话会极大的增加文章的篇幅,减少文章的可读性,因此仅以截图展示,需要的小伙伴可以点击这里即可免费获取!
Java面试宝典2021版
最常见Java面试题解析(2021最新版)
2021企业Java面试题精选
…(img-m0GwJgNl-1620812396551)]
[外链图片转存中…(img-VILopCmB-1620812396552)]
2021企业Java面试题精选
[外链图片转存中…(img-rbOBZ4rp-1620812396553)]